Description (eCommerce)
SA2 is a component of the multisubunit cohesin complex. Cohesin functions to hold sister chromatids together during meiosis and mitosis and ensure proper segregation of chromosomes. Cohesin must dissociate from sister chromatids during prophase and metaphase so that they can segregate to opposite poles of the cell during anaphase. As part of the cohesin complex, SA2 appears to play a role in cohesin dissociation required for sister chromatid separation. Interestingly, SA2 has been demonstrated to also exhibit transcriptional regulatory activity through an association with NF-kappaB.

About Storage Conditions
All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ity.
We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
